Transaction 08784676eb5eb5252f81537e693649f15af1ec921c4d90cc47d868f132095b29
1 Input
2 Outputs
- 08784676eb5eb5252f81537e693649f15af1ec921c4d90cc47d868f132095b29:0
- 08784676eb5eb5252f81537e693649f15af1ec921c4d90cc47d868f132095b29:1
value 2495044
address 1KHwtS5mn7NMUm7Ls7Y1XwxLqMriLdaGbX
value 87496
address bc1qqnvt4e9yxav5vycv8jt43y7s2vxe3ka9fshjy0